How To Make Berry-Topped Blintz Bake
This sweet Russian dessert is made with two kinds of cheeses before finally topping it off with a variety of flavorful berries.
Ingredients
Blintz:
- 4 oz cream cheese, softened
- 8 oz curd cottage cheese
- 3 eggs, plus one egg yolk
- ¼ cup sugar
- ½ cup flour
- ¾ tsp vanilla
- ¾ cup sour cream
- ¼ cup milk
- ¼ cup butter, melted
- 1 tsp. lemon peel, grated
- 1 tsp baking powder
Topping:
- 1 cup mixed berries, fresh or frozen , thawed
- ¾ cup blackberry of blueberry syrup
Instructions
Preparing the Blintz:
-
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F
- Butter an 8-inch square dish with 2-inch high sides (2 quart pan).
-
To make the blintz, place cream cheese, cottage cheese, the egg yolk, 1 tbsp of sugar, 1 tbsp of flour and vanilla in a blender container.
- Blend on low speed until smooth, stopping and scraping down side of container once.
- Transfer cheese mixture to bowl; set aside.
- Do not wash blender.
- Place the 3 eggs, sour cream, milk, butter and lemon peel in blender container.
-
Blend on medium speed until smooth. Add combined ½ cup flour, ¼ cup sugar and 1 tsp baking powder.
- Blend on high speed until smooth.
- Pour half of the batter into the baking dish.
- Drop small spoonfuls of cheese mixture in evenly spaced rows on top of batter.
- Pour remaining batter on top.
- Bake until puffy and edges begin to turn golden, about 45 minutes.
Preparing the topping:
- To make topping, combine berries and syrup in a small saucepan.
- Heat over low heat until warm, stirring occasionally.
- Cool blintz on wire rack for 5 minutes.
- To serve, cut into squares; top with berries.
